At its core, a dog leash is a fundamental tool for guiding and controlling your dog in various environments. It serves as a vital link, ensuring safety for both your pet and the public, preventing escapes, and facilitating effective communication during walks or training sessions. Beyond basic restraint, a well-chosen leash can significantly impact your dog’s comfort and your ability to manage them, making outdoor activities a joy rather than a struggle.

Among the many options available, the bungee cord dog leash stands out due to its unique construction. Unlike traditional static leashes, bungee leashes incorporate elastic sections designed to absorb sudden shocks. This elasticity cushions impacts when your dog pulls or lunges, transforming abrupt jolts into gentle, progressive resistance. This innovative design not only protects your dog’s neck and joints but also minimizes strain on your arm and shoulder, making it an excellent choice for active owners and strong pullers.

Common Types of Dog Leashes and Their Pros and Cons

Understanding the different types of leashes available helps highlight why bungee leashes have become such a popular choice for many dog owners.

  • Standard Leash (Fixed-Length):
    • Pros: Simple, straightforward, durable, generally affordable, and easy to maintain. Provides consistent control.
    • Cons: Offers no shock absorption, making sudden pulls harsh on both dog and owner. Can cause discomfort or injury if a dog pulls consistently.
  • Retractable Leash:
    • Pros: Allows dogs more freedom to explore within a given range, as the length can be adjusted on the fly.
    • Cons: Often difficult to control a dog effectively, especially in crowded areas. The sudden “lock” can be jarring, potentially causing neck injuries or even entanglement for dogs and handlers. Many trainers advise against them due to safety concerns and lack of consistent communication.
  • Training Leash (Multi-Functional or Long Line):
    • Pros: Typically longer (up to 30 feet or more) or features multiple loops/clips, offering versatility for obedience training, recall practice in open spaces, or providing more exploration freedom while maintaining a tether.
    • Cons: Can be cumbersome in urban or crowded settings due to excessive length. Requires good handling skills to prevent tangling or tripping.
  • Bungee Cord Leash:
    • Pros: Features an elastic section that absorbs shock from sudden pulls, reducing strain on the dog’s neck and the owner’s arm. Enhances comfort, promotes smoother walks, and is excellent for active pursuits like running or hiking. Many are hands-free compatible.
    • Cons: May reduce precise control in very crowded areas due to its stretch. Some believe it could inadvertently encourage pulling if not paired with proper training, as the “give” can feel less restrictive. It might also be a bit heavy for very small dogs.

Comparison Table of Dog Leash Types

Leash Type Pros Cons Suitable For
Standard Leash Simple, durable, affordable No shock absorption, harsh on pulls Everyday walks, well-trained dogs
Retractable Leash Allows freedom to roam Poor control, potential injury from jerks/tangles Experienced users in open, uncrowded spaces
Training Leash Versatile lengths for recall and exploration Can be cumbersome, requires skill to manage Training, spacious areas, specific exercises
Bungee Cord Leash Shock-absorbing, comfortable, reduces strain, hands-free options Less precise control in crowds, can be heavy for small dogs Active owners, strong pullers, running, hiking

Guide to Buying the Perfect Bungee Cord Dog Leash: Factors to Consider

Choosing the right bungee cord dog leash involves more than just picking a color. Several factors contribute to its effectiveness, comfort, and safety for both you and your dog.

  • Material Quality: The durability and performance of a bungee leash largely depend on its materials. Look for robust, high-tensile materials like reinforced nylon webbing or specialized stretch webbing. These materials are chosen for their ability to withstand tension, resist wear and tear, and often feature weather-resistant properties for longevity. Strong stitching is also crucial to prevent fraying and ensure the leash holds up against strong pulls.
  • Elasticity and Flexibility: The core feature of a bungee leash is its elastic component. The bungee should offer a balance—strong enough to absorb significant force, yet flexible enough to provide a gentle, gradual resistance rather than a harsh snap. This balance ensures optimal shock absorption without completely compromising your ability to communicate with your dog. Some leashes feature a single bungee section, while others might incorporate double bungees for enhanced shock absorption.
  • Length: The ideal length varies based on your dog’s size, your height, and the activity.
    • 1.2m – 1.8m (4-6 feet): This is a popular length for general walking, providing a good balance of control and freedom. For activities like running or hiking, a length within this range can offer comfortable hands-free use when paired with a waist belt, maintaining a safe distance while allowing your dog to move naturally.
    • 3m – 5m (10-16 feet): Longer leashes are excellent for allowing more freedom during casual ambles in parks or for training exercises like recall in open, uncrowded areas. However, these lengths require more awareness in busy environments.
    • Activity-Specific Lengths: For high-speed activities such as bikejoring or skijoring, a longer line, around 2.8 meters (9 feet) when extended, might be recommended to create a safe distance between your dog and your gear.
  • Width (Strength): The width and overall strength of the leash should be proportionate to your dog’s size and pulling power. A heavier, stronger pulling dog will require a wider, more robust leash to ensure durability and safety, preventing the leash from snapping or wearing out prematurely. Lighter bungee options are available for smaller breeds.
  • Hardware (Clasps and Hooks): The connecting hardware is a critical safety component. Ensure clasps and hooks are made from sturdy, rust-resistant materials like aluminum or stainless steel. Look for secure locking mechanisms, such as locking carabiners or strong bolt clips, that are easy to operate but prevent accidental unlatching. Swivel clasps are a bonus, as they help prevent the leash from tangling.
  • Handle Comfort: For your comfort, especially on longer walks or with strong pullers, a padded or ergonomically designed handle is invaluable. Neoprene-lined handles or comfortable webbing can prevent hand strain and leash burns, making the experience more pleasant. For hands-free options, a comfortable, adjustable waist belt with secure attachments is essential.
  • Safety Features: Modern bungee leashes often come with additional safety elements. Reflective stitching or strips are highly recommended for increasing visibility during low-light conditions, such as early morning or evening walks. Some leashes also include a “traffic handle” closer to the clip, providing an extra point of control for quickly reining in your dog in crowded or potentially hazardous situations.

Tips for Using and Maintaining Your Bungee Cord Dog Leash

To maximize the benefits and extend the lifespan of your bungee cord dog leash, proper usage and diligent maintenance are essential.

  • Correct Attachment: Always double-check that your leash is securely fastened to your dog’s harness or collar. Verify that the clasp is fully closed and locked (if applicable) before heading out. Using a bungee leash with a harness is often recommended over a collar to better distribute force across your dog’s chest and shoulders, further reducing strain on their neck.
  • Proper Handling and Control: While bungee leashes absorb shock, maintaining an active hand is still key. Hold the leash firmly but comfortably, allowing the bungee to do its job during sudden pulls. For hands-free models, ensure the waist belt is snug but not restrictive, providing a stable connection without discomfort. In crowded areas, use a traffic handle or shorten the leash temporarily to keep your dog close and prevent tangles with passersby.
  • Avoiding Tangles: The elasticity of a bungee leash can sometimes lead to tangling, especially in busy environments or with highly energetic dogs. Be mindful of your surroundings and your dog’s movements. Regularly inspect the leash during walks to ensure it hasn’t become wrapped around your dog’s legs or other obstacles.
  • Regular Inspection: Periodically examine the entire leash for signs of wear and tear. Look for frayed webbing, stretched-out bungee sections, cracks in the handle, or any damage to the metal hardware (clasps, rings). A compromised leash can fail when you need it most, so replace it if you notice any significant damage.
  • Cleaning and Storage: Depending on the material, most bungee leashes can be easily cleaned. Nylon and polyester leashes can often be hand-washed with mild soap and water, or sometimes machine-washed on a gentle cycle (check manufacturer instructions). Always allow the leash to air dry completely before storing to prevent mildew and material degradation. Store your leash in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ight and extreme temperatures, to prolong its elasticity and overall lifespan.
  • Safety in Public: Even with a shock-absorbing leash, situational awareness is paramount. Bungee leashes excel in open spaces for activities like running or hiking. However, in highly crowded urban areas or near busy roads, their stretch might give your dog more slack than desired for immediate control. In such cases, keep the leash shorter or use a secondary control handle.
